Why The Dutch Approach Is Different

The first thing you will notice is the mindset. In many countries, civil engineering is about building bigger bridges or higher towers. In the Netherlands, it is about resilience, sustainability, and integration. The country is largely below sea level. This isn’t a metaphor. It is a daily logistical reality. Consequently, the curriculum here emphasizes hydraulic engineering, geotechnical mechanics, and smart urban planning far more rigorously than elsewhere.

You are essentially training to manage a complex, living system. The Dutch approach is pragmatic. There is less room for abstract theory that doesn’t have a clear application. This makes the education rigorous but highly relevant. When you graduate, you aren’t just carrying a diploma. You are carrying a toolkit that is immediately applicable to global challenges like climate change and urbanization.

Top Universities And Their Specialties

Not all programs are created equal. The Netherlands has a handful of institutions that dominate the field, each with its own flavor. It helps to pick the one that aligns with your specific interests.

  • Delft University of Technology (TU Delft): This is arguably the heavyweight champion. TU Delft is consistently ranked among the top civil engineering schools globally. Their strength lies in water engineering, structural dynamics, and transportation. If you want to work on large-scale infrastructure or cutting-edge hydraulic projects, this is the place. The competition is fierce, and the workload is heavy. Expect to be challenged constantly.
  • Eindhoven University of Technology (TU/e): TU/e takes a different angle. They focus heavily on innovation, design, and smart systems. Their civil engineering program is intertwined with computer science and industrial design. If you are interested in digital twins, AI in infrastructure, or sustainable building materials, TU/e offers a more forward-looking, tech-centric curriculum.
  • University of Twente: Known for its high-tech systems engineering, Twente is smaller and more intimate. They emphasize personal supervision and interdisciplinary projects. It is a great fit if you prefer a collaborative environment over a massive lecture hall setting. Their focus on "personal technology" translates well into human-centric infrastructure planning.
  • Wageningen University & Research (WUR): If your interest leans heavily towards environmental engineering, spatial planning, or ecosystem management, WUR is unique. They don’t just build structures; they look at how those structures fit into the natural environment. It is less about concrete and more about coexisting with nature.

Admissions: What Actually Matters

Getting in requires more than just good grades. Dutch universities are straightforward about their expectations. There is little room for vague statements. Your Bachelor’s degree must be closely aligned with the Master’s program you are applying to. This is the biggest hurdle for international students. A generic engineering degree might not cut it.

You need to check the ECTS requirements meticulously. Most programs require a specific number of credits in mathematics, mechanics, and fluid dynamics. If your transcript shows a gap in these core subjects, you will likely be asked to take preparatory courses or face rejection. Don’t guess. Read the course specifications on the university websites. They are explicit about which Bachelor’s courses map to which Master’s modules.

English proficiency is non-negotiable. IELTS or TOEFL scores are standard. However, the real test is your motivation letter. Admissions committees want to know why you want to study there. Generic letters get tossed. They want to see that you understand the Dutch approach to engineering. Mention specific professors, research groups, or projects that interest you. Show that you have done your homework.

Life Beyond The Lecture Hall

Studying in the Netherlands is also about adapting to a unique culture. The work-life balance is respected, even for students. You will find a relaxed but efficient social atmosphere. Dutch people are direct. In academic settings, this means feedback is honest and immediate. It can feel harsh if you are used to more indirect criticism, but it is incredibly helpful for growth. There is no hidden agenda. If your design is flawed, they will tell you. If it is good, they will say so.

Housing is the elephant in the room. Historically, student cities like Delft and Eindhoven have faced severe housing shortages. You need to start looking for accommodation months in advance. It is stressful. Many students live slightly further out and commute by train. The Dutch rail system is excellent, so this is a viable long-term strategy. Budget accordingly. Living costs are moderate but not cheap, especially when you factor in rent.

Career Prospects And Migration

The job market for civil engineers in the Netherlands is robust. There is a structural shortage of engineers, particularly in the infrastructure, water management, and renewable energy sectors. International students are in high demand. Many large firms like Royal HaskoningDHV, Arcadis, and Sweco actively recruit from these universities.

After graduation, you can apply for the Orientation Year visa. This allows you to stay in the Netherlands for up to a year to look for work. It is a generous window, given the competitive job markets elsewhere. The language barrier can be a minor issue. While English is the working language in many engineering firms, learning basic Dutch will significantly expand your social circle and integrate you better into local projects. It is not always required for high-tech roles, but it helps.
